2010-08-27 113 views
3

我使用WinCVS中,當我嘗試更新模塊,我不斷收到此錯誤CVS更新錯誤

CVS [更新中止]:從服務器上讀取:錯誤-1

什麼是這裏的實際問題以及如何解決這個問題?

+2

你使用pserver風格的連接,SSH隧道或其他?您計算機上的存儲庫,網絡內部的另一臺計算機還是Internet上的存儲庫? (如果它不是您的計算機,它運行Windows還是其他操作系統?)是否有任何最近的網絡拓撲更改?你還能從服務器做一個新的結賬嗎? – 2010-09-27 23:00:42

+2

像亞瑟一樣,我認爲更多的細節會很有用......你可以從不同的機器訪問同一個倉庫嗎?你可以嘗試從一個Linux命令行(你可能能夠獲得關於錯誤的更多信息)? – Matthieu 2010-09-28 12:53:15

+0

其pserver風格的連接。該存儲庫跨越互聯網,服務器正在運行RedHat Linux。我不確定是否有任何網絡拓撲發生了變化。我可以簽出並提交,只有更新失敗。 – 2010-10-02 14:52:42

回答

0

您的反病毒/防火牆可能是這裏的問題。 禁用/卸載它們並重試。

+0

我試着禁用wincvs的防火牆。當我嘗試更新現在我仍然得到錯誤CVS [更新中止]:寫入到服務器套接字:錯誤-1 – 2010-09-15 17:41:35

0

這是一個鏈接,它給出了爲CVS找到的錯誤的描述。檢查是否這可以幫助您解決您的問題 -

http://www.thathost.com/wincvs-howto/cvsdoc/cvs_21.html

+0

錯誤說明沒有用,因爲它們不包括「讀取」。故障排除提示可能很有用,但由於OP沒有打擾回答有關訪問方法的問題,因此我們無法使用它。 – 2010-09-30 17:00:32

0

你能不能做一個整體的檢出,但沒有更新?

我在工作中遇到了同樣的錯誤,令人費解的是與服務器上的訪問權限有關的問題。要知道你是否有同樣的問題,請同事嘗試用他自己的登錄名。

0

當壓縮變成off時,我已經看到了奇怪的問題,這取決於CVS客戶端/服務器版本。對於我們許多問題的解決方案是使用壓縮(最低設置就足夠了),即使在局域網上,這也不是必需的。不知道消息是什麼,但也許這可以幫助你。

1

我有這個和類似的問題,通過嘗試在我的CVSROOT pserver字符串上的變體解決,以包括用戶名@主機名/ cvs。另外CVS註銷,然後再次登錄。 不知道它爲什麼起作用,因爲它們應該是等效的。

+0

那麼這是否會產生任何結果?正如我所說,我只是有同樣的問題,上面的「扭曲」解決。 – MikeW 2013-01-09 08:49:29

+1

CVS註銷爲我工作。以前我已經獨立地重新安裝了TortoiseCVS和CVS客戶端,並重新啓動了多次。沒有結果。然後,我在控制檯中執行了「CVS註銷」並嘗試更新。它要求密碼,然後再次運行。 – 2016-11-01 14:31:23